The Czech Republic to Receive An Additional 200 Million Dollars from USA As Compensation for the Supply of Equipment to Ukraine

(Source: Czech Republic Ministry of Defence; issued Feb 16, 2023)
(Unofficial translation by Defense-Aerospace.com)

The Ambassador of the United States of America, Bijan Sabet, informed today that the United States, as part of foreign military cooperation, will provide the Czech Republic with an additional 200 million dollars as partial compensation for the equipment that the Czech Republic provided to Ukraine.

"We greatly appreciate this help, which we perceive as an expression of appreciation for how the Czech Republic has been helping Ukraine since the beginning of the conflict. We will use the funds to further modernize our army," said Defense Minister Jana Černochová, adding that negotiations on specific projects will still be held.

The newly announced 200 million dollars (converted to approx. 4.4 billion crowns) will come from the Foreign Military Financing program. This is another donation in addition to the previously announced $100 million, which is also intended for the further modernization of the Army of the Czech Republic and for partial compensation of our supplies of material to Ukraine, and another already mentioned six million dollars from the Fund for Countering Russian Influence intended for building so-called deployable cyber protection teams that will be created within the Czech Army.
